Signs of a true dream from Allah

Dreams are one of the most powerful ways in which Allah communicates with His servants on earth. But how do we know if a dream is from Allah? This article will explore some of the signs that a dream is from Allah, so that we can be sure that it is a true dream and not a mere product of our own imaginations.

The first sign that a dream is from Allah is that it is clear and unambiguous. Dreams that are vague, confusing, or hard to interpret are not likely to be from Allah. If the dream is clear and contains a message that is easy to understand, then it is likely to be from Allah.

The second sign that a dream is from Allah is that it is in accordance with the teachings of Islam. Allah’s message to His servants will always be in accordance with the teachings of Islam, so if the dream contains something that goes against the teachings of Islam, then it is not likely to be from Allah.

The third sign that a dream is from Allah is that it is not disturbing or frightening. Dreams from Allah will always contain a message of comfort and hope, not fear and dread. If the dream is disturbing or frightening in any way, then it is not likely to be from Allah.

Dreams that contain warnings

Some dreams from Allah may contain warnings or advice about a particular situation. If the dream contains a warning or advice that is in accordance with the teachings of Islam, then it is likely to be from Allah. It is important to remember that Allah’s warnings or advice will always be for our benefit, so it is important to take them seriously and act upon them.

Dreams from Allah may also contain predictions about the future. These predictions will always be in accordance with the teachings of Islam and will be for the benefit of the person receiving the dream. If the dream contains a prediction that is in accordance with the teachings of Islam, then it is likely to be from Allah.

Prayer and meditation

The best way to know if a dream is from Allah is to seek guidance through prayer and meditation. Allah is always listening, and He will always answer our prayers. If we sincerely ask Allah to guide us and help us to interpret our dreams, then He will surely answer our prayers.

Another way to know if a dream is from Allah is to seek the advice of a knowledgeable scholar. A knowledgeable scholar can help us to interpret our dreams and determine whether they are from Allah or not.

Dreams that come true

Finally, one of the signs that a dream is from Allah is if it comes true. If the dream contains a prediction that comes true, then it is likely to be from Allah. It is important to remember, however, that not all dreams that come true are from Allah, so it is important to seek guidance from a knowledgeable scholar if we are unsure.

5. Is it possible to have a dream from the devil?

Yes, it is possible to have a dream from the devil, although it is not as common as having a dream from Allah. Dreams from the devil are likely to contain messages that are contrary to the teachings of Islam, as the devil seeks to lead people astray. These dreams may also contain elements of fear and anxiety, as the devil seeks to create chaos and destruction. If you have a dream that you believe is from the devil, it is important to seek guidance from a religious leader and to recite the Qur’an regularly to protect yourself from the influence of the devil.
